Plant Care & Growing Tips

Caring for your red wax apple live plant involves understanding its tropical origins to provide the best possible growing conditions. These trees thrive in warm, humid environments, making them ideal for USDA zones 9-11. They prefer a location in your garden that receives full sun, ideally at least 6-8 hours of direct sunlight daily, though they can tolerate partial shade, especially in areas with intense afternoon sun. Ensure the chosen spot has well-drained soil to prevent root issues.

Consistent watering is crucial for a healthy tropical fruit plant. Keep the soil consistently moist, particularly during the active growing and fruiting seasons. Water deeply and regularly, making sure the entire root zone is hydrated, but be careful not to overwater, as waterlogged soil can lead to root rot. Applying a layer of mulch around the base of the tree will help retain soil moisture, regulate soil temperature, and suppress weed growth. Fertilize your wax apple fruit tree with a balanced fertilizer formulated for fruit trees during its growing season, following the product’s instructions for dosage and frequency. Avoid fertilizing during the dormant period.

Pruning should be done annually to maintain the tree’s shape, remove any dead or diseased branches, and encourage good airflow and sunlight penetration throughout the canopy. The best time for major pruning is typically during the dormant season, but you can remove suckers and water sprouts as they appear throughout the year. Protect your air layered fruit tree from strong winds, which can damage branches and ripening fruit. In cooler climates, consider growing your plant in a large container that can be moved indoors during colder temperatures to protect it from frost.

The wax apple fruit tree can grow to a mature height of 15-30 feet in ideal conditions, though container-grown plants will remain smaller and can be pruned to maintain a desired size. The fruit itself is typically small to medium-sized, about the size of a small apple, with a smooth, waxy skin that ripens to vibrant hues of pink or red. Expect fruit production within 1-3 years of planting, given proper care and environmental conditions.
